Valve Proving System
i. A valve proving system, as show schematically below, is standard on the
FB-S Boilers. When the boiler operating sequence is initiated, the burner
control box energizes the proving system, which then carries out the
following checks.
a. Valves V1, V2 and V3 are initially closed. The proving
system then opens V3 and then closes it after 2 seconds.
b. V1, V2 and V3 remain closed for 23 seconds while the
minimum side of the gas pressure switch (PS) checks
for an increase in pressure. If no crease occurs there is
no leakage past V1 and the sequence continues.
c. V1 is opened for 2 seconds and then closed. V1, V2
and V3 again remain closed for 23 seconds while the
maximum side of the gas pressure switch checks for
a decrease in pressure. If no decrease occurs there is
no leakage past V2 or V3 and the burner operating
sequence will continue.

Flame Monitor
i.
An ultraviolet cell is fitted as standard on all burners. It monitors the status
of the flame, any failure will cause the burner to shut down.
